In this video, we introduce Similitude. Often in fluid mechanics, we need to scale problems up or down to be able to better understand them or make easier observations. Similitude ensures that we preserve geometric, kinematic (velocity), and dynamic (force) scaling.

Through the video, we follow the work of William Froude on ship drag analysis and help him properly scale his problem down to something he can do in the lab. We learn all about how physics can break when we scale improperly, and how challenging scaling can be.

In practice, we need scaling for modeling and measurements of complex hydrodynamic and aerodynamic problems.
